sealskin
Sealskin is the fur of a seal, used to make coats and other clothing.

sealskin in American English
the skin or pelt of the fur seal, esp. with the coarse outer hair removed and the soft undercoat dyed dark-brown or black
adjective: made of sealskin
noun: the skin of a seal

sealskin in British English
noun: the skin or pelt of a fur seal, esp when dressed with the outer hair removed and the underfur dyed dark brown
